Exploring the Chinese Food Landscape in Estes Park
When seeking Chinese food Estes Park CO, it’s important to manage your expectations in terms of authenticity. You’re more likely to find Americanized Chinese dishes, which are adapted to suit local tastes. While this may not be the same as dining in a bustling Chinatown, it still offers a satisfying culinary experience. These dishes are generally altered from their original recipe.
The focus on fresh ingredients can vary depending on the establishment. Some restaurants prioritize sourcing local produce and meats, enhancing the flavor and quality of their dishes. Others rely on more traditional methods and ingredients.
Spice levels are usually adjustable, so don’t hesitate to request your food with a milder or spicier kick. Many restaurants offer a range of sauces and condiments to customize the heat level to your preference.
Vegetarian, vegan, and gluten-free options are becoming increasingly common. Inquire about specific dishes and modifications to accommodate your dietary needs.
The service and atmosphere tend to be friendly and welcoming. Whether you’re dining in or taking out, you can expect a relaxed and casual environment.
